Specialist Risk Group (SRG), the insurance intermediary, has acquired Anthony James Insurance Brokers in a move that is set to expand and further strengthen SRG’s retail pillar – Specialist Risk Insurance Solutions (SRIS).
Subject to regulatory approval, Anthony James becomes SRG’s fifth acquisition since it announced its new investment partners, Warburg Pincus and Temasek, in May this year.
Established in 2009, Anthony James provides insurance services for organisations across the UK, with it’s expertise spanning across a number of sectors, including commercial, corporate, and high-net worth personal lines.
It has been confirmed that the company’s Chairman and founder, Steve Boorman, and Managing Director, Jacob Duckworth, will continue to lead the business following completion of the acquisition.
